- java.lang.Object
-
- java.lang.Enum<AccessibleRole>
-
- javafx.scene.AccessibleRole
-
- すべての実装されたインタフェース:
Serializable,Comparable<AccessibleRole>
public enum AccessibleRole extends Enum<AccessibleRole>
この列挙は、Nodeのアクセス可能な役割を記述します。 この役割は、スクリーン・リーダーなどのアシスティブ・テクノロジでノードのアクションおよび属性のセットを決定する際に使用されます。 たとえば、スクリーン・リーダーがスライダの現在の値を必要とする場合、値属性を使用して現在の値をリクエストします。 スクリーン・リーダーがスライダの値を変更する場合は、スライダの現在の値を設定するアクションを使用します。 スライダはこの両方のリクエストに適切に対応する必要があります。
-
-
列挙型定数のサマリー
列挙型定数 列挙型定数 説明 BUTTONボタンの役割。CHECK_BOXチェック・ボックスの役割。CHECK_MENU_ITEMチェック・メニュー・アイテムの役割。COMBO_BOXコンボ・ボックスの役割。CONTEXT_MENUコンテキスト・メニューの役割。DATE_PICKER日付ピッカーの役割。DECREMENT_BUTTON減分ボタンの役割。HYPERLINKハイパーリンクの役割。IMAGE_VIEWイメージ・ビューの役割。INCREMENT_BUTTON増分ボタンの役割。LIST_ITEMリスト・アイテムの役割。LIST_VIEWリスト・ビューの役割。MENUメニューの役割。MENU_BARメニュー・バーの役割。MENU_BUTTONメニュー・ボタンの役割。MENU_ITEMメニュー・アイテムの役割。NODEノードの役割。PAGE_ITEMページの役割。PAGINATIONページ区切りの役割。PARENT親の役割。PASSWORD_FIELDパスワード・フィールドの役割。PROGRESS_INDICATOR進捗状況インジケータの役割。RADIO_BUTTONラジオ・ボタンの役割。RADIO_MENU_ITEMラジオ・メニュー・アイテムの役割。SCROLL_BARスクロール・バーの役割。SCROLL_PANEスクロール・ペインの役割。SLIDERスライダの役割。SPINNERスピナーの役割。SPLIT_MENU_BUTTONスプリット・メニュー・ボタンの役割。TAB_ITEMタブ・アイテムの役割。TAB_PANEタブ・ペインの役割。TABLE_CELL表セルの役割。TABLE_COLUMN表列の役割。TABLE_ROW表行の役割。TABLE_VIEW表ビューの役割。TEXTテキストの役割。TEXT_AREAテキスト領域の役割。TEXT_FIELDテキスト・フィールドの役割。THUMBサムの役割。TITLED_PANEタイトル付きペインの役割。TOGGLE_BUTTONトグル・ボタンの役割。TOOL_BARツール・バーの役割。TOOLTIPツールチップの役割。TREE_ITEMツリー・アイテムの役割。TREE_TABLE_CELLツリー表セルの役割。TREE_TABLE_ROWツリー表行の役割。TREE_TABLE_VIEWツリー表ビューの役割。TREE_VIEWツリー・ビューの役割。
-
-
-
列挙型定数の詳細
-
BUTTON
public static final AccessibleRole BUTTON
-
CHECK_BOX
public static final AccessibleRole CHECK_BOX
チェック・ボックスの役割。属性:
アクション:
-
CHECK_MENU_ITEM
public static final AccessibleRole CHECK_MENU_ITEM
-
COMBO_BOX
public static final AccessibleRole COMBO_BOX
-
CONTEXT_MENU
public static final AccessibleRole CONTEXT_MENU
-
DATE_PICKER
public static final AccessibleRole DATE_PICKER
-
DECREMENT_BUTTON
public static final AccessibleRole DECREMENT_BUTTON
-
HYPERLINK
public static final AccessibleRole HYPERLINK
-
INCREMENT_BUTTON
public static final AccessibleRole INCREMENT_BUTTON
-
IMAGE_VIEW
public static final AccessibleRole IMAGE_VIEW
イメージ・ビューの役割。属性:アクション:
イメージのテキスト記述を各
ImageViewに対して提供することを強く推奨します。 これは、Node.accessibleTextProperty()をImageViewに設定するか、AccessibleAttribute.LABELED_BYを使用して設定できます。
-
LIST_VIEW
public static final AccessibleRole LIST_VIEW
-
LIST_ITEM
public static final AccessibleRole LIST_ITEM
リスト・アイテムの役割。属性:
アクション:
-
MENU
public static final AccessibleRole MENU
-
MENU_BAR
public static final AccessibleRole MENU_BAR
メニュー・バーの役割。属性:
アクション:
-
MENU_BUTTON
public static final AccessibleRole MENU_BUTTON
-
MENU_ITEM
public static final AccessibleRole MENU_ITEM
-
NODE
public static final AccessibleRole NODE
ノードの役割。属性:
-
AccessibleAttribute.ROLE -
AccessibleAttribute.PARENT -
AccessibleAttribute.SCENE -
AccessibleAttribute.BOUNDS -
AccessibleAttribute.DISABLED -
AccessibleAttribute.FOCUSED -
AccessibleAttribute.VISIBLE
-
AccessibleAttribute.TEXT -
AccessibleAttribute.LABELED_BY -
AccessibleAttribute.ROLE_DESCRIPTION -
AccessibleAttribute.HELP
-
-
PAGE_ITEM
public static final AccessibleRole PAGE_ITEM
ページの役割。属性:
アクション:
-
PAGINATION
public static final AccessibleRole PAGINATION
ページ区切りの役割。属性:
アクション:
-
PARENT
public static final AccessibleRole PARENT
-
PASSWORD_FIELD
public static final AccessibleRole PASSWORD_FIELD
-
PROGRESS_INDICATOR
public static final AccessibleRole PROGRESS_INDICATOR
進捗状況インジケータの役割。属性:
-
AccessibleAttribute.VALUE -
AccessibleAttribute.MIN_VALUE -
AccessibleAttribute.MAX_VALUE -
AccessibleAttribute.INDETERMINATE
-
-
RADIO_BUTTON
public static final AccessibleRole RADIO_BUTTON
-
RADIO_MENU_ITEM
public static final AccessibleRole RADIO_MENU_ITEM
-
SLIDER
public static final AccessibleRole SLIDER
-
SPINNER
public static final AccessibleRole SPINNER
-
TEXT
public static final AccessibleRole TEXT
-
TEXT_AREA
public static final AccessibleRole TEXT_AREA
テキスト領域の役割。属性:
-
AccessibleAttribute.TEXT -
AccessibleAttribute.FONT -
AccessibleAttribute.EDITABLE -
AccessibleAttribute.SELECTION_START -
AccessibleAttribute.SELECTION_END -
AccessibleAttribute.CARET_OFFSET -
AccessibleAttribute.OFFSET_AT_POINT -
AccessibleAttribute.LINE_START -
AccessibleAttribute.LINE_END -
AccessibleAttribute.LINE_FOR_OFFSET -
AccessibleAttribute.BOUNDS_FOR_RANGE
-
-
TEXT_FIELD
public static final AccessibleRole TEXT_FIELD
-
TOGGLE_BUTTON
public static final AccessibleRole TOGGLE_BUTTON
-
TOOLTIP
public static final AccessibleRole TOOLTIP
ツールチップの役割。属性:アクション:
-
SCROLL_BAR
public static final AccessibleRole SCROLL_BAR
-
SCROLL_PANE
public static final AccessibleRole SCROLL_PANE
スクロール・ペインの役割。属性:
-
AccessibleAttribute.CONTENTS -
AccessibleAttribute.HORIZONTAL_SCROLLBAR -
AccessibleAttribute.VERTICAL_SCROLLBAR
-
-
SPLIT_MENU_BUTTON
public static final AccessibleRole SPLIT_MENU_BUTTON
スプリット・メニュー・ボタンの役割。属性:
アクション:
-
TAB_ITEM
public static final AccessibleRole TAB_ITEM
タブ・アイテムの役割。属性:
アクション:
-
TAB_PANE
public static final AccessibleRole TAB_PANE
タブ・ペインの役割。属性:
アクション:
-
TABLE_CELL
public static final AccessibleRole TABLE_CELL
-
TABLE_COLUMN
public static final AccessibleRole TABLE_COLUMN
-
TABLE_ROW
public static final AccessibleRole TABLE_ROW
-
TABLE_VIEW
public static final AccessibleRole TABLE_VIEW
表ビューの役割。属性:
-
AccessibleAttribute.ROW_COUNT -
AccessibleAttribute.ROW_AT_INDEX -
AccessibleAttribute.COLUMN_COUNT -
AccessibleAttribute.COLUMN_AT_INDEX -
AccessibleAttribute.SELECTED_ITEMS -
AccessibleAttribute.CELL_AT_ROW_COLUMN -
AccessibleAttribute.HEADER -
AccessibleAttribute.MULTIPLE_SELECTION -
AccessibleAttribute.VERTICAL_SCROLLBAR -
AccessibleAttribute.HORIZONTAL_SCROLLBAR -
AccessibleAttribute.FOCUS_ITEM
-
-
THUMB
public static final AccessibleRole THUMB
-
TITLED_PANE
public static final AccessibleRole TITLED_PANE
タイトル付きペインの役割。属性:
アクション:
-
TOOL_BAR
public static final AccessibleRole TOOL_BAR
-
TREE_ITEM
public static final AccessibleRole TREE_ITEM
ツリー・アイテムの役割。属性:
-
AccessibleAttribute.TEXT -
AccessibleAttribute.INDEX -
AccessibleAttribute.SELECTED -
AccessibleAttribute.EXPANDED -
AccessibleAttribute.LEAF -
AccessibleAttribute.DISCLOSURE_LEVEL -
AccessibleAttribute.TREE_ITEM_COUNT -
AccessibleAttribute.TREE_ITEM_AT_INDEX -
AccessibleAttribute.TREE_ITEM_PARENT
-
-
TREE_TABLE_CELL
public static final AccessibleRole TREE_TABLE_CELL
-
TREE_TABLE_ROW
public static final AccessibleRole TREE_TABLE_ROW
-
TREE_TABLE_VIEW
public static final AccessibleRole TREE_TABLE_VIEW
ツリー表ビューの役割。属性:
-
AccessibleAttribute.ROW_COUNT -
AccessibleAttribute.ROW_AT_INDEX -
AccessibleAttribute.COLUMN_COUNT -
AccessibleAttribute.COLUMN_AT_INDEX -
AccessibleAttribute.SELECTED_ITEMS -
AccessibleAttribute.CELL_AT_ROW_COLUMN -
AccessibleAttribute.HEADER -
AccessibleAttribute.MULTIPLE_SELECTION -
AccessibleAttribute.VERTICAL_SCROLLBAR -
AccessibleAttribute.HORIZONTAL_SCROLLBAR -
AccessibleAttribute.FOCUS_ITEM
-
-
TREE_VIEW
public static final AccessibleRole TREE_VIEW
-
-
メソッドの詳細
-
values
public static AccessibleRole[] values()
この列挙型の定数を含む配列を、宣言されている順序で返します。 このメソッドは、次のようにして定数を反復するために使用できます。for (AccessibleRole c : AccessibleRole.values()) System.out.println(c);
- 戻り値:
- この列挙型の定数を含む配列(宣言されている順序)
-
valueOf
public static AccessibleRole valueOf(String name)
指定された名前を持つ、この型の列挙型定数を返します。 文字列は、この型の列挙型定数を宣言するのに使用した識別子と厳密に一致している必要があります。 (不適切な空白文字は許可されません。)- パラメータ:
name- 返される列挙型定数の名前。- 戻り値:
- 指定された名前を持つ列挙型定数
- 例外:
IllegalArgumentException- 指定された名前を持つ定数をこの列挙型が持っていない場合NullPointerException- 引数がnullの場合
-
-